I have a question. What if the data is continuously being written to the datastore entities while the export process is being initiated? Does it take all the data or a point in time data when the job was started?

It does not always take all the data which is continuously being written while the export process is running. After the job was started, the export process is separated by each entity and is proceeded asynchronously. So it takes a point in time data around when the job was started.
